some were good some were bad.....When I used to drive a cab, I had a ton of celeb's in the car.....My favorite was Myron Cohen.....When he was alone, he tipped BIG......a dime.....when he was with his wife he only tipped a nickle....and this was only 30 yrs ago lol......Redd Foxx was the worst....would take a cab from the strip to his house.....out around Eastern if I remember right.....you were lucky if he had enough for the fare....NEVER a tip.....

Sammy Davis, was $20 no matter where he was going...the fare usually ran 4-5 dollars....
